What a Virtual Assistant Does for an Amazon Wholesale Seller

Wholesale operations involve massive amounts of repeating, data-intensive work: catalog analysis, price list processing, competitive research, and account health monitoring. A VA trained in wholesale operations can own that workload entirely, freeing you to focus on supplier relationships and purchasing decisions.

Task How a VA Helps
Price list analysis and ASIN lookup Processes supplier price lists, matches UPCs to ASINs, and calculates projected ROI per unit
Competitor buy box monitoring Tracks who owns the buy box on your shared ASINs and flags pricing opportunities
Wholesale supplier outreach Researches and cold contacts brand reps, follows up on applications, and maintains your supplier pipeline
Account health dashboard monitoring Reviews your Account Health dashboard daily and flags any policy warnings or metric dips
Stranded and suppressed listing resolution Identifies stranded inventory and suppressed listings and executes the standard fix workflows
Reorder and PO management Tracks sell-through velocity by ASIN and prepares draft POs for your approval
FBA inventory reconciliation Audits FBA inventory reports and files reimbursement claims for discrepancies

The Real Cost of Doing It All Yourself

Wholesale sellers often start out processing price lists manually — opening an Excel file, looking up ASINs one by one in Seller Central or Keepa, and calculating ROI in a spreadsheet. That process works for your first ten suppliers. It does not scale to fifty.

When you're the only person doing catalog analysis, you become the bottleneck for every purchasing decision. Profitable price lists sit unprocessed while you're on a call with a supplier. By the time you get to them, the buy box landscape has shifted or another wholesale seller has already secured the brand. Speed of analysis is a genuine competitive advantage in wholesale, and a VA who can process price lists faster than you can creates real revenue impact.

Account health is the other hidden cost. Wholesale sellers managing large catalogs often don't notice policy warnings until they escalate into listing removals or account flags. A VA monitoring your health dashboard daily catches those issues while they're still minor and keeps your account standing strong.

Wholesale sellers who scale past $1M in annual revenue consistently cite catalog research bandwidth as the primary constraint on growth — not capital, not supplier access, but time to analyze and act on the opportunities already in front of them.

How to Delegate Effectively as an Amazon Wholesale Seller

The fastest leverage point for wholesale delegation is price list analysis. Invest time once in building a clear spreadsheet template and analysis rubric — minimum ROI percentage, maximum number of competitors, buy box ownership criteria — and your VA can process every future price list without your involvement. You receive a shortlist of approved ASINs and make the final purchasing call.

Supplier outreach is the second high-leverage delegation. Build a supplier prospecting SOP that covers how to find brand websites, how to locate the wholesale or rep contact, and what your initial outreach email says. Your VA can work through 20 to 30 outreach contacts per week, keeping your supplier pipeline full without consuming your selling hours.

For account health, create a daily monitoring checklist and a response playbook for the most common issues. Your VA checks the dashboard each morning, resolves anything on the standard playbook, and escalates anything unusual to you by the end of the day.

Tip: Use a shared project management tool like Asana or Notion to track every open task across supplier outreach, price list analysis, and account health. Your VA works from the board and updates statuses in real time, giving you full visibility without daily check-in meetings.
